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ma attorneys specialize in asbestos litigation, including lawsuits and claims against trust funds. They must be aware of the complex laws of the state and national legal requirements to effectively handle these types of claims.

They should also be able to access asbestos databases that list contaminated job sites and determine which asbestos manufacturers could be responsible for exposure. An asbestos lawyer who is knowledgeable makes the process of filing a lawsuit simple so that victims can concentrate on treatment and spending time with their loved ones.

Experience

A lawyer who has handled asbestos cases for a long time is an asset in your case. The best asbestos lawyers have a track record of obtaining compensation for their clients and families. You can use online resources like FindLaw to research attorneys and law firms who specialize in asbestos litigation. Once you have a list of attorneys and law offices, speak with them to confirm that they can meet your requirements.

The first step in filing an asbestos lawsuit is meeting with a mesothelioma attorney to get an assessment of your case at no cost. Your lawyer will help you determine which companies are accountable for your case, and what type of claim is most appropriate. Asbestos exposure can come in a variety of forms which makes it difficult for asbestos victims to recall the exact date or location they were exposed. Mesothelioma lawyers have access to databases which provide a list of thousands of companies and products, as well workplaces where exposure to asbestos took place.

Asbestos lawyers also know how they can investigate a case to find evidence that will prove your claim. You might have medical records that prove that you were diagnosed with mesothelioma lawsuit or an official death certificate that states "mesothelioma". Asbestos lawyers are aware of the procedure to obtain these documents and what questions to ask in order to get the most of them.

A mesothelioma lawyer who's knowledgeable will also know how state laws affect the method you file your lawsuit. In New York, for example you have to file your lawsuit within the state if the business that exposed you to asbestos is located there. Attorneys from nationwide firms will have experience in filing claims across multiple states and are aware of the laws in each jurisdiction.

The law firm Simmons Hanly Conroy represents more than 3,000 patients with mesothelioma and their families. Its national trial lawyers have been instrumental in recovering billions of dollars in settlements and verdicts. Lawyers from this firm are committed to defending the rights of victims and their families. They only handle just a handful of cases at time, so they can give each client and their family the attention they deserve.

Reputation

A mesothelioma lawyer should be well-known in the community for their dedication to asbestos victims and their commitment to justice. They should also be experienced in fighting big corporations that place profits ahead of safety for workers. The most effective lawyers have decades of experience and an impressive track record of obtaining compensation for victims.

The legal procedure for mesothelioma lawsuits and other asbestos-related illnesses is complex and requires an attorney with an established track record. A reputable mesothelioma lawyer can explain the legal process and make suggestions for the best course of action. Their knowledge of mesothelioma lawsuits, trust fund claims and other asbestos-related issues is essential to ensure that their clients receive the maximum compensation possible.

Many lawyers are also specialized in other types asbestos litigation, such as cases which involve lung cancer or asbestos exposure among veterans. Kazan Law, for instance, specializes in filing asbestos lawsuits against veterans and other workers diagnosed with mesothelioma, or any other asbestos-related disease. Kazan Law also has experience filing claims with bankruptcy settlement trusts, which is crucial for those who have been exposed to asbestos in a variety of states.

Mesothelioma is a painful, life-threatening disease that affects the lining of the lungs and chest cavity. The disease is caused by asbestos exposure which has been used in commercial and residential building products for over 30 years. Exposure to asbestos can occur in a variety of places, including at work, at school, or at home.

A person who has been diagnosed with mesothelioma can bring a lawsuit for personal injury against the company who exposed them to asbestos. They can also file for the wrongful death of loved ones who have died from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ses.

Asbestos victims can recover financial compensation for expenses such as lost wages, medical bills and the costs of treatment. Asbestos attorneys can help their clients recover damages through mesothelioma lawsuits or trust fund claims against companies who are accountable for asbestos exposure. They can also aid their clients in filing a wrongful death lawsuit on behalf a loved one who has died from mesothelioma.

Personality

The most effective mesothelioma lawyers have a positive attitude and can explain complex legal issues in a simple manner. They will also keep you updated about the progress of your case, so you'll never be in not knowing what's going on.

You can find mesothelioma lawyers in your local phone book, in ads or on the internet. You can also get suggestions from your family and friends advocacy groups, or support communities. Once you have a list of possible lawyers, meet them to ensure that they are the right fit for you and your requirements.

When choosing a mesothelioma lawyer be sure to find a lawyer who has experience winning compensation for clients just like you. They should be able explain how they can assist you to obtain the compensation you need to cover your medical expenses, lost wages and other damages, such as pain and suffering.

Mesothelioma victims and their families need monetary compensation to cover the cost of medical treatments. The cost can be huge and could be made worse by lost income due to absence from work. A mesothelioma specialist can help you get the maximum amount of compensation for your losses.

A mesothelioma lawyer ought to be able to show you the history of cases that have been successful and settlements made for their clients. They should also be able answer any questions you might have regarding the process of obtaining compensation. This includes the time it will take for your claim to be accepted and refunded.

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ma can provide you with a consultation free. During this appointment, you can discuss your asbestos exposure with your lawyer and decide how you want to proceed. This could involve a lawsuit or trust, or seeking compensation from the VA.

A mesothelioma lawyer business should have a dedicated team of lawyers who have years of asbestos-related experience. They should have a strong reputation and a history of success helping their clients get compensation. They should be able to provide you with testimonials from previous clients as well as a detailed written overview of the legal process.

Trustworthiness

Asbestos was a component of various products. It was an inexpensive and popular filler but can cause serious health problems if inhaled. Asbestos victims, as well as their families have received significant compensation from companies that were negligent in the production of asbestos-based products. These compensations can assist victims in paying medical bills, pay debt, and improve their lives.

Asbestos attorneys will help mesothelioma patients file a lawsuit for exposure to asbestos against responsible parties. The most experienced mesothelioma attorneys will have a long history of success and extensive experience. They should have handled thousands of mesothelioma lawsuits, and have won millions for their clients. They should also be familiar with mesothelioma trust fund and asbestos bankruptcy laws.

Attorneys need to be able communicate effectively and make their clients feel at ease. They should be able and willing to address questions and concerns in a simple comprehendable manner and provide regular updates on the status of their case. If they are able they should be able to meet with clients in person.

Mesothelioma lawyers should have a solid background in law, but they also need to be sensitive and understanding. They must have empathy for the families of the victims and be able to listen to their stories and be interested in the outcome of every case.

Mesothelioma lawyers should be able connect their clients to mesothelioma cancer centers as well as doctors. They should be able to access all the most recent research and treatments for mesothelioma. They should be able to provide evidence that exposure to asbestos is the reason for lung cancer and m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ases.

A mesothelioma attorney can help determine if a patient has an appropriate claim and assist the patient file a lawsuit, VA claim or trust fund. Each mesothelioma case is unique and based on several factors, including the extent of exposure to asbestos, the victim's age at diagnosis, as well as the amount of money they have lost due to the disease. Compensation can include past and future medical costs as well as lost wages, the loss of a loved one, legal fees, punitive damages and pain and discomfort.
